A gave 40% of amount to B. B gave 20% of amount received
from A to C. If amount received by C from B is Rs.180, then find the amount received by B from A.Solution
Let A had Rs.x with him. According to question, => 40% of 20% of x = 180 => 0.08x = 180 => x = 2250 Amount received by B from A = 40% of 2250 = Rs.900
